There are different methods used to set up single sign on authentication. One method is where you allow the computer to store the user’s name and password, after it is initially authenticated at first log in. From that point on, anytime the user initiates a resource which requires authentication, the computer automatically performs the request in the background, without requiring the user for any further input.

Depending on where your business is located, will determine what people call a digital signature. In European countries, this type of signature is referred to as an EU qualified signature, or simply shortened to EU qualified. The main thing to remember is that, regardless of the name used, they are the same thing. The primary difference is an EU qualified signature is recognized by the EU as a trusted source issued by an approved certificate authority.

A root certificate is the part of a digital certificate which is responsible for performing authentication processes. The data contained in the root is normally encrypted to prevent other people making changes to the certificate. When you connect to a service or resource which requires this certificate, it uses the data to verify the certificate is authentic and is a correct match.

When you digitally sign a document using your digital signature, you are encrypting the document before sending it off. However, the receiving person has no idea whether they can trust the document without authenticating it. The best way for them to perform the authentication is to obtain a PKI certificate issued by a third party source, which is trusted. This outside party also would have issued your digital signature. By using an outside trusted source, others are able to authenticate your signature and trust the documents really came from you and not someone else.
